Taxi App

How to Develop a Bike Taxi App

  • Published on : December 2, 2021

  • Read Time : 10 min

  • Views : 4.8k


On-demand bike taxi apps- the fresh addition to urban commutes is increasingly gaining popularity in the hustle and bustle of highly-populated cities like Vietnam, India, Cambodia, etc.

Hailed as a cheaper and faster alternative to taxi booking apps; the Bike taxi app development solution has emerged as a lucrative business investment idea.

Ease of riding bikes in the congested traffic, low incomes of a rising middle-class family, and the reduced riding rates are the key drivers of success in the Asia Pacific Taxi Market.

As per Statista, the estimated revenue of the ride-hailing market is expected to show an annual growth rate of 11.02% that means the projected market volume will grow to US$ 392,580m by 2025; with 48% of total revenue to be generated alone by online sales.

This soaring market of bike taxi software definitely calls for a post that dives in-depth into the tried, tested, and successful way to develop a market-leading motorcycle taxi booking app.

Let’s quickly get started!

How to Develop a Bike Taxi App: A Lucrative Business Venture

Developing a bike taxi app solution involves creating a seamless platform for riders, drivers, and administrators. Key features include easy onboarding, live route tracking, multiple payment options, and promotional offers. When you consider successful business models like Gojek, Rapido, Ola Bikes, UberMoto, and SafeBoda, the development cost ranges from USD 20,000 to USD 40,000, with phases like planning, designing, development, and testing contributing to the overall investment.

How Does A Bike Taxi App Works?

After successfully registering on the app, the bike taxi app works in 3 simple steps:

  1. Passenger enters a pickup and drop off location(Views estimated trip fare with the time of arrival)
  2. Taps on ‘Book a Ride’(Passenger receives the driver’s detail, estimated trip fare with time of arrival)(The biker accepts the ride request and reaches the pick-up location)
  3. As soon as the trip ends, passenger pays the bike rider via m-wallet, card, or cash.(The passenger can rate and review the overall ride experience)

Top Market Players of Bike Taxi App


  • Gojek An on-demand bike and taxi booking app platform offering ride-hailing and hyperlocal delivery services for consumers and businesses. Founded in Jakarta (Indonesia), Gojek is also hailed for offering on-demand delivery services of food, groceries, and packages. Note: This can be your 2nd USP if you look to add value to your bike taxi app development solution.
  • Rapido Rapido is India’s leading bike taxi app available for both Android and iOS app platforms. Power-packed with features like GPS, insured rides, real-time tracking, multiple payments, and more, Rapido has established a dominating presence on the streets of India. Rapido is founded in Bangalore (India) and is currently running in more than 100 cities with 25 Million+ app downloads.
  • Ola Bikes Ola Bikes app is the most popular ride-hailing service in India that offers a well-protected ride with top-of-the-line features like multiple payment options including Ola money, real-time tracking, secure OTP for every ride, Ride scheduling, corporate rides, and more.
  • UberMoto UberMoto is a unique personalized bike service launched by Uber. The app allows users to book bikes and scooters and match shorter distances from point A to point B; which also includes last-mile connectivity.
  • SafeBoda Safeboda is an Africa-based on-demand moto-taxi booking app that works on the ethics and social mission of safety, reliability, and trust amidst the driver and passenger. With Android and iOS app platforms, the SafeBoda app provides a safe, more convenient, and mobile-first alternative to urban transportation for Africa’s flourishing population.

The Must-Have Features in a Bike Taxi Software

There are 3 major stakeholders in the bike taxi app development solution that makes the ride-booking process seamless and easier for both rider and driver.

  1. Rider/Passenger App
  2. Driver App
  3. Admin Panel

Rider/Passenger App

  1. Easy Onboarding The rider should be able to quickly register in the app through mobile number, social accounts, and email id.
  2. Request a Ride Riders should be able to book a ride with a few taps i.e. simply by entering the pick-up and drop-off location.
  3. Maps Integrate maps for live route tracking, location visibility, and matching pick up and drop-off locations.
  4. Multiple Payments Mode Riders should get multiple payment options such as cash, card, digital wallets, and UPI payments.
  5. Push Notifications Riders should be able to get real-time alerts for updates like driver arriving, reached, offers, promotions, etc.
  6. Trip History Allow riders to check the previous booking history made through the app.
  7. Contact Driver Riders should be able to contact the driver for pick-up coordination.
  8. Rate and Review By enabling user feedback on the app you can increase the positive evaluation rate and increase engagement.
  9. Offers and Promos Offers and promo codes lure users to book rides. It’s a good way to increase your app installs and ride bookings.

Driver App Features

  1. Easy Registration Drivers’ registration should include a collection of all necessary documents like scanned copies of driving license, photo, vehicle insurance, etc.
  2. Set Active Status Give drivers the flexibility to operate part-time or full-time, go for a break when they want. All this can be done by allowing them to set their active status through toggles of online/offline.
  3. GPS Navigation A great pick up and drop off happens only when the driver reaches on time. Thankfully by integrating GPS navigation, you can enable drivers to track the optimized pickup and drop off route of customers on live- maps.
  4. Track Earnings Drivers are motivated by an income target for sure. Allowing drivers to track their daily/weekly earnings helps them to set their monetary goals and maximize productivity to reach goals.
  5. View Ratings Ratings are always seen as a performance report for Admin as well as the Driver. After each trip, as the rider rates the driver based on their trip experience, drivers should have the opportunity to view the individual ratings sent by the particular trip or person.

Admin App Features

  1. Interactive Dashboard Admin should have a bird’s-eye view of all the ongoing rides, total earnings, total active riders and drivers through an interactive dashboard.
  2. Manage Drivers Admin can add/remove drivers, see their personal details, message them personally, or broadcast messages to all drivers.
  3. Manage Customers Admin can activate/deactivate customers, access their contact details, book a ride on behalf of them and send them messages.
  4. Manage Notifications Admin should be able to manage the notifications to be sent to drivers and passengers.
  5. Manage Offers Admin can set offers, promo codes and discounts and incentives to referral rides.
  6. Manage Reviews Admin can manage reviews submitted by riders and take action on them like reading, replying, and removing.
  7. Manage Earnings Admin can check total daily earnings, manage the mode of payments and check earnings made by individual drivers.

How Much does it Cost to Develop a Bike Taxi App?

The total cost to developing and maintaining a Bike taxi management software ranges somewhere between USD 20, 000- USD 40,000.  This includes project planning, UI/UX prototype development, iOS and Android app development, and quality assurance. Factors influencing costs involve app complexity, features, and the development company’s expertise.

However, there are several factors that decides the cost of creating an app product. Since serious mobile apps require a strong conceptual foundation, there goes an excellent ecosystem involving top talents in-app project planning, designing, and engineering. Therefore, the true cost to bike taxi app development bifurcates into different phases performed by the taxi app development company.

The activities that include major cost breakup are:

  • Project planning and management
  • UI/UX prototype development and designing
  • iOS and Android app development
  • Quality assurance and testing

Perhaps, the most important foundation to gearing up for all these points and creating a great taxi app is doing your research. Take the time to make sure how your app will play out in both long-term and short term. As per the research, draft your app-building strategies.


Need help in-app research and planning? Competitor assessment and strategy building? Don’t fret. You’re at the right place. Codiant is your end-to-end mobile app development partner having strong expertise in building bike taxi app software and other leading on-demand mobility solutions. Connect with us for a quick app demo that exactly matches your requirement. Let’s together build a great story of your brand.

Complimentary Taxi App Demo for Ambitious Entrepreneurs. Interested?

Contact us today!

    Let's talk about your project!

    Featured Blogs

    Read our thoughts and insights on the latest tech and business trends

    How Remote Hiring Shortens Recruitment Cycles

    Feeling the pressure to fill a critical role, but your recruitment process feels like it's moving at snail pace? You're not alone. Traditional hiring methods can be slow and cumbersome, costing your company valuable time... Read more

    Codiant Is Now A Certified Google Partner

    We're excited to share that Codiant – A Yash Technologies Company has earned official recognition as a Certified Google Partner. This milestone underscores our ongoing dedication to delivering premium digital solutions and keeping pace with... Read more

    How Our Dedicated Team Avoided Costly Delays in Aircraft Project

    The clock was ticking. Flyrocks, a global leader in digital records management for an aviation giant, was facing a critical challenge: upgrading their core web platform for managing aircraft data. The project was complex, demanding... Read more